Feel like everyone is getting a bailout except you?
For two weeks now, Chef Morin and his staff have been randomly selecting at least one table per day to be “bailed out” at his popular restaurant and bar at Yonge and King.



A ballout on the resto's cheque
The financial district's Beerbistro launched its stimulus package a couple of weeks ago, whereby each day at least one randomly selected table will, instead of a cheque receive a card announcing that they've been "bailed out" of dinner and that their bill is on the house.
